在当今的数字化时代,局域网网页的搭建对于组织内部的信息传递和管理具有重要意义。无论是企业还是学校,都可以通过搭建局域网网页来提高工作效率和信息共享能力。本文将介绍如何搭建一个简单而实用的局域网网页。
一、准备工作
- 硬件设备
- 需要一台服务器:可以是物理服务器或虚拟机。
- 网络设备:交换机、路由器等,以确保所有计算机在同一局域网内可以相互通信。
- 软件环境
- 操作系统:推荐使用Windows Server系列或者Linux系统,具体取决于您的熟悉程度和需求。
- Web服务器软件:如Apache、Nginx、IIS等。
- 数据库:MySQL、PostgreSQL等,用于存储网页数据。
- 编程语言和框架:如PHP、Python(Django/Flask)、JavaScript(Node.js)等。
二、配置Web服务器
1. 安装操作系统和必要的软件
假设我们选择的是Linux系统,可以使用Ubuntu作为示例。首先需要安装操作系统,然后通过命令行工具进行以下操作:
sudo apt update
sudo apt install apache2 # 安装Apache Web服务器
2. 配置防火墙
确保防火墙允许HTTP(80)和HTTPS(443)端口的访问:
sudo ufw allow 'Apache Full'
3. 测试服务器
在浏览器中输入服务器的IP地址,如果看到Apache的默认欢迎页面,说明Web服务器已成功安装并运行。
三、编写和部署网页内容
1. 创建网页文件
将您的网页文件放置在Apache的默认根目录/var/www/html
下,例如创建一个名为index.html
的文件:
<!DOCTYPE html>
<html>
<head>
<title>局域网网页</title>
</head>
<body>
<h1>欢迎访问我们的局域网网页!</h1>
</body>
</html>
2. 重启Apache服务
保存修改后,需要重启Apache服务以使更改生效:
sudo systemctl restart apache2
再次打开浏览器刷新页面,您应该可以看到自定义的网页内容。
四、添加数据库支持
如果需要动态内容或用户数据存储,可以考虑使用数据库。以下是如何在本地服务器上安装MySQL并进行基本配置的方法:
sudo apt install mysql-server
sudo mysql_secure_installation # 进行安全设置
sudo mysql -u root -p # 登录到MySQL
CREATE DATABASE mydb; # 创建一个新数据库
GRANT ALL PRIVILEGES ON mydb.* TO 'user'@'localhost' IDENTIFIED BY 'password'; # 创建用户并授权
FLUSH PRIVILEGES; # 重新加载权限表
现在您可以在网页应用程序中连接这个数据库,实现数据的存储与管理。
五、进一步优化与安全措施
- SSL认证: 如果对安全性要求较高,可以为网站配置SSL证书,启用HTTPS协议。
- 备份与恢复: 定期备份网页内容和数据库,以防数据丢失。
- 权限管理: 确保只有授权用户才能访问或修改网页文件和数据库。
通过以上步骤,您已经成功搭建了一个基本的局域网网页。根据实际需求,您可以继续扩展功能和优化性能。希望这篇文章能够帮助您顺利完成局域网网页的建设任务。